Your Key Responsibilities And Impact
- Use a range of video, audio and digital equipment and information technology to research, write, assemble, edit and deliver outputs in the appropriate medium, to the highest professional standards
- Exercise editorial judgment in developing story ideas and producing accurate and impartial journalism on deadline
- Provide editorial and production support to News Editors and Senior Journalists, contributing to a dynamic, collaborative and inclusive newsroom
- Liaise closely with other team members and with other departments in the BBC, to ensure that output material is shared, duplication is avoided, and best practice is upheld
- Take a lead within a team setting or on delivering a specific piece of journalism or project as appropriate
- Collaborate across digital and linear platforms to reimagine how audiences engage with BBC News content
- Contribute to BBC digital video, text, live pages, and social media with sharp, engaging journalism
- Maintain a deep understanding of global events and leverage BBC’s global newsgathering resources
- Work a primetime evening and weekend schedule, including late shifts up to midnight
- At all times to carry out duties in accordance with the BBC health and safety policy
YOUR SKILLS AND EXPERIENCE
- Significant recent experience as a journalist in a global newsroom, with a good knowledge of production techniques
- Demonstrates sound editorial and policy decisions based upon a clear understanding of the BBC’s distinctive news agenda, the requirements of news and current affairs coverage and the audience
- Ability to use technology as required, in order to gather material for broadcast
- Understands how a team works effectively
- Able to build and maintain effective working relationships with a range of people
- Demonstrates a commitment to improving diversity in the BBC and understands how individual differences can benefit the BBC
- Effective planning and organising skills, ability to concentrate on several areas of work at one time, delivering consistently to deadlines and reacting positively to changes and conflicting priorities
- Ability to write creatively in an engaging manner, adapt, produce and translate with accuracy, clarity and style appropriate to differing audiences and forms of media suitable for multimedia output
- The flexibility and adaptability to sustain performance, particularly under pressure to meet deadlines and changing priorities and circumstances
